About South Lincoln School

South Lincoln School is a public elementary school in Fayetteville, TN, part of Lincoln County. South Lincoln School serves approximately 653 students, and covers grades Pre-K-8th, and has a 16.7:1 student-teacher ratio. South Lincoln School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.6 out of 10 and ranks #1,221 of 1,786 schools in TN.

Structured state assessment records for South Lincoln School show 51%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 48%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).
